On sunday I went to check out the Shafdan singles in west Rishon Lezion.
the city has build a nice trail system that winds through willow trees and along a seasonal lake. the singel is very fast and flowing. flying throght the wilow branches makes you dodge and duck some of the invading branches.
the whole ride, in the middle of an isolated terrain and in pitch black with only the beam of my head torch to show me the way felt very sureal and omenious. but I was also surprised how fun it was and how riding in the dark adds to the adrenalin and excitment of what, during the day light, would be a mandane ride.
[Shafdan single (with approach) – 17.1 k”m – 1:13 hrs. – avg. 14.1 km/h ]
